自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(3)
  • 资源 (2)
  • 问答 (2)
  • 收藏
  • 关注

原创 Android studio安装app时报错 Error: Activity class {} does not exist

Android studio安装app时报错 Error: Activity class {} does not exist## 标题 最近经常遇到一些稀奇古怪的问题,比如说启动的时候编译一直是可以的,在install的时候一直失败,报错就是没找到app的入口Activity,经过反复研究发现,应该是卸载或者某次安装过程突然中断导致的,解决的版本就是使用adb命令uninstall一次就可以了,问题不大,但是纠结了很久真的是脑阔疼啊… adb uninstall 你的applicationId ...

2020-09-12 10:44:13 652

原创 解决ViewPager设置高度无效问题,从源码角度分析并解决问题

解决ViewPager设置高度无效问题,从源码角度分析并解决问题 大家在开发中使用ViewPager做轮播之类的控件时,是不是会遇到当想设置它的高度时,怎么写都不生效,这其实是ViewPager的设计思想导致的,起初ViewPager就是为了做全屏的滑动切换,所以在它的源码中onMeasure中第一步就设置了自己的宽高 源码中已经设定了默认使用父View的宽高,我们真实的需求其实大多都是希望ViewPager根据自己的子View高度来自适应自己的高度 而我们遇到这个问题时,一般来说都是不知道问度娘… 当我们

2020-07-05 15:38:09 900 1

原创 for循环删除list时报错 java.util.ConcurrentModificationException的解决方案

ArrayList<Integer> arrayList = new ArrayList<>(); for (int i = 0; i < 20; i++) { arrayList.add(Integer.valueOf(i)); } Iterator<Integer> iterator = arrayList.iterator(); while (...

2019-06-27 17:15:41 214

kotlin编写的使用RecyclerView实现的一个可吸顶的二级列表

最近在学习Kotlin,所以咋学习其他知识的时候会想着用kotlin去实现,这次是一个使用RecyclerView实现的可吸顶的二级列表,使用的是自定义的ItemDecoration实现的,使用Canvas绘制的,demo简单可供各位参考。

2020-09-20

FlowViewDemo.rar

使用kotlin语音编写的一个简易自定义标签流式布局,使用了google推荐使用的kotlin语言,可以在学习自定义view的过程中同时熟练自己使用kotlin的能力

2020-07-05

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除